Kansas v. Cline

Petition for certiorari denied on January 8, 2024

Docket No. Op. Below Argument Opinion Vote Author Term
23-335 Kan. Ct. App. N/A N/A N/A N/A OT 2023

Issue: Whether the exclusionary rule applies to suppress evidence where a court has found the use of excessive force in the execution of an otherwise lawful seizure, given that other adequate remedies to deter police misconduct exist.
